Objective: To teach the students about nutrients and nutrition mode in plants (autotrophism and heterotrophism)
Subtopics to be covered:
- Photosynthesis
- Saprotrophs, symbiotic relationship
- How nutrients are refilled in soil
Learning Outcome:
- Students know about the various nutrition modes in plants
- They know about the substances produced during photosynthesis (O2 and CO2)
- They should be able to explain why farmers are adding manures and fertilizers to soil

1. Ask students to list out the various colours of leaves that they have observed.
2. Make the students to ask around about fertilizers. What do the most common fertilizers contain?
3. Ask the students to name some parasites that they have observed. What are their hosts?
4. Take a piece of bread and moisten it with water. Leave it in a moist warm place for 2–3 days or until fluffy patches appear on them. These patches may be white, green, brown or of any other colour. What could this be?
